Compositions and methods of treatment of inflammatory skin conditions using allantoin
Abstract
Embodiments herein provide formulations and methods for treatment of inflammatory skin diseases using allantoin in an amount from about 0.5% to about 15.0% by weight. Inflammatory skin diseases treated by embodiments herein include, without limitation, cutaneous porphyria, sclerodema, epidermolysis bulosa, psoriasis, decubitus ulcers, pressure ulcers, diabetic ulcers, venous stasis ulcers, sickle cell ulcers, ulcers caused by burns, eczema, urticaria, atopic dermatitis, dermatitis herpetiform, contact dermatitis, arthritis, gout, lupus erythematosus, acne, alopecia, carcinomas, psoriasis, rosacea, miliaria, skin infections, post-operative care of incisions, post-operative skin care following any variety of plastic surgery operations, skin care following radiation treatment, care of dry, cracked or aged skin and skin lines as well as other conditions affecting the skin and having an inflammatory component, symptoms thereof, or a combination thereof. Symptoms treated may include pain, inflammation, redness, itching, scarring, skin thickening, milia, or a combination thereof.
Claims

A composition comprising an oil-in-water emulsion comprising allantoin in an amount from about 3.0% to about 15% by weight and a pharmaceutically acceptable excipient, wherein the composition further comprises an emollient, an emulsifier, a solvent, and a pH modifier; and the pH is between about 4.0 and about 5.0.
2 . The composition of claim 1 , wherein the amount of allantoin is about 6.0% to about 15% by weight.
3 . The composition of claim 1 , wherein the amount of allantoin is about 6.0% to about 10% by weight.
4 . The composition of claim 1 further comprising a solubilizing agent, an antioxidant, a preservative, a chelating agent, an additive, a viscosity agent or a combination thereof.
5 . The composition of claim 1 further comprising a fragrance.
6 . The composition of claim 1 further comprising tetrasodium EDTA.
7 . The composition of claim 6 , wherein the tetrasodium EDTA is in an amount from about 0.05% to about 0.5%.
8 . The composition of claim 1 , wherein the emulsion comprises: water; cetyl alcohol; stearyl alcohol; beeswax; sodium lauryl sulfate in a 30% solution; citric acid; lanolin oil; propylene glycol; tetrasodium EDTA; cod liver oil; butylated hydroxytoluene; methylparaben; propylparaben or a combination thereof.
9 . The composition of claim 8 , wherein the emulsion comprises: water in an amount from about 40 to about 90%; cetyl alcohol in an amount from about 0.5 to about 15%; stearyl alcohol in an amount from about 1% to about 3%; beeswax in an amount from about 1.5% to about 3%; sodium lauryl sulfate in a 30% solution in an amount from about 1.5% to about 3%; citric acid in an amount from about 0.5% to about 0.2%; lanolin oil in an amount from about 5% to about 15%; propylene glycol in an amount from about 2% to about 8%; tetrasodium EDTA in an amount from about 0.05% to about 0.5%; cod liver oil in an amount from about 0.05% to about 5%; butylated hydroxytoluene in an amount from about 0.05% to about 1%; methylparaben in an amount from about 0.05% to about 0.5%; propylparaben in an amount from about 0.05% to about 0.5% by weight of the formulation or a combination thereof.
